(29-10-2014, 10:46 AM)Mike Senior Wrote: Latest version has the vocals slightly submerged under the band in the choruses. I can see the thinking here, in terms of trying to make the band seem powerful, but I think you've overdone it a bit. I'd try to get less power out of the cymbals, more out of the guitars/piano and then sneak up the vocals a little more. Nice verse vocal sound -- like that a lot.
